Cornet loses two games in WTA win in Morocco

MARRAKECH, Morocco, April 23 (UPI) -- Alize Cornet dropped just two games Tuesday in a first-round victory at the WTA's tournament in Morocco.

Cornet is the No. 3 seed this week but the highest left the tournament, which has a formal title of Grand Prix Sar La Princesse Lalla Meryem. Top-seeded Dominika Cibulkova withdrew from the event and No. 2-seeded Sorana Cirstea lost a first-round match Monday.

Cornet, however, advanced by beating Fatima Zahrae El Allami 6-1, 6-1 in an hour. One of the games Cornet lost was a service break but she still took 71 percent of the points on serve and two-thirds when receiving serve.

Fourth-seeded Kaia Kanepi got past Anabel Medina Garrigues 4-6, 6-3, 6-2. She ended up with six breaks, including three in the third set.

Kiki Bertens, the fifth seed and defending champion, defeated Timea Babos 7-5, 6-2, while No. 7-seeded Kristina Mladenovic took out Alexandra Cadantu 6-4, 4-6, 6-4 in a 2 1/2-hour battle, and ninth-seeded Tsvetana Pironkova stopped Karolina Pliskova 7-5, 6-1.

In other first-round matches Tuesday Lourdes Dominguez Lino beat Misaki Doi 6-2, 4-6; 6-2; Mandy Minella advanced over Estrella Cabeza Candela 7-6 (7-3), 4-6, 7-5; Silvia Soler-Espinosa defeated Michaela Honcova 7-6 (7-4), 6-2; Simona Halep eliminated Nina Bratchikova 6-1, 6-3; and Karin Knapp rolled over Lina Qostal 6-0, 6-1.
